What is an Espresso Machine with a Steam Wand?
An espresso machine with a steam wand is a flexible coffee-making gadget that not only brews rich and delicious espresso shots but likewise has an integrated steam wand for frothing and steaming milk. This allows users to create a wide range of coffee beverages that need numerous types of milk textures, such as:
- Cappuccino: A shot of espresso topped with a thick layer of frothed milk.
- Latte: A shot of espresso integrated with steamed milk and a light froth.
- Macchiato: An espresso "stained" with a small amount of steamed milk.

Key Features to Look For
When picking an espresso machine with a steam wand, it's necessary to think about numerous features that will boost your coffee-making experience:
-
Type of Steam Wand:
- Commercial-Style: Allows for accurate control and develops microfoam perfect for latte art.
- Panarello: A beginner-friendly wand that streamlines the frothing process.
-
Boiler System:
- Single Boiler: Can brew espresso and steam milk but not simultaneously.
- Heat Exchange: Allows for developing and steaming at the same time.
- Dual Boiler: Provides individual temperature level control for espresso and steam.
-
Ease of Use:
- Look for instinctive controls, including programmable settings and easy to use interfaces.
-
Maintenance:
- Choose models that are easy to tidy, with removable elements and automatic cleansing functions if possible.
-
Develop Quality:
- Durable products such as stainless-steel make sure durability and effectiveness.
